Oracle SID配置指南有效解决实例连接问题(oracle sid配置)

Oracle SID配置指南:有效解决实例连接问题

Oracle是目前业界使用最广泛的关系型数据库管理系统之一,但在使用中,常常会遇到实例连接问题。这篇文章旨在介绍如何正确配置Oracle SID,以有效解决实例连接问题。

什么是Oracle SID?

Oracle SID是系统标识符(System ID)的缩写,是Oracle实例的唯一标识。它是全局唯一的。一般情况下,一个Oracle服务器可以有多个实例,每个实例都有自己的SID。

为什么需要配置Oracle SID?

正确配置Oracle SID可以使数据库管理员在连接到特定的实例时更加方便,同时也可以避免一些连接错误或者性能问题的出现。

如何配置Oracle SID?

在Oracle安装后,默认情况下会自动创建一个实例,但这个实例的SID默认为ORCL,可能会与其他实例的SID冲突。所以在使用前,需要修改或者配置新的SID。

下面是配置Oracle SID的基本步骤:

1.登录SQL*Plus

SQL*Plus是Oracle的一个命令行工具,可以在Windows中运行,接下来我们将在SQL*Plus中配置Oracle SID。打开命令行窗口,输入以下命令登录SQL*Plus:

sqlplus /nolog

2.连接到Oracle数据库

在登录SQL*Plus后,需要使用以下命令连接到Oracle数据库:

SQL>connect / as sysdba

如果提示ORA-12162,说明数据库实例没有启动。

如果在服务器上安装并启动了多个数据库实例,则需要使用以下语法:

SQL> connect username/password@database_SID

其中,username和password是Oracle用户的名称和密码,而database_SID是Oracle实例的SID。

3.查看和修改Oracle SID

使用以下命令可以查看当前的Oracle实例的SID:

SQL>show parameter db_name

如果需要修改当前实例的SID,使用以下命令:

SQL>alter system set db_name=new_SID scope=both;

这里的new_SID是你想设置的新的SID。

4.重新启动Oracle实例

修改SID后,需要重新启动Oracle实例以使改变生效。可以使用以下命令重新启动Oracle实例:

SQL>shutdown immediate;

SQL>startup;

到这里,我们就完成了Oracle SID的配置。

总结

Oracle SID是Oracle实例的唯一标识符,配置正确的SID可以避免连接错误或者性能问题的出现。本文介绍了如何在SQL*Plus中配置Oracle SID的基本步骤。希望本文可以帮助到Oracle用户,解决实例连接问题。


数据运维技术 » Oracle SID配置指南有效解决实例连接问题(oracle sid配置)